Scream With Excitement over NCL’s Halloween Festivities

MIAMI, OCT 19 – Calling all witches, goblins and ghosts; Norwegian Cruise Line (NCL) invites guests to enjoy Halloween on the high seas. Guests can book last-minute on NCL ships and take advantage of great deals that are no trick, just a treat for those looking for a high-style Halloween getaway.

All NCL and NCL America ships sailing over October 31 have created special Halloween festivities including haunted house theme parties, trick-or-treating, dance and costume contests and festive entertainment. For example, Norwegian Star will bring back the disco era with an 80s-themed Halloween Prom, a haunted house and a special performance of Michael Jackson’s Thriller by the ship’s dancers. Norwegian Sun will offer cruisers Halloween activities such as trick or treat bingo, a children’s haunted house and midnight horror movie screenings. Pride of America will celebrate in style with a celebrity look-a-like contest, a spooky maze and a “Monster Mash” with band, along with a Halloween carnival for children.

All ships will also feature frightening Halloween-themed cocktails such as the Vampire, made with vodka, black raspberry liqueur and cranberry juice, along with Dracula’s Kiss, made with black cherry vodka, grenadine and coca-cola. Special buffet treats will also be featured including: pecan caramel spiders, pumpkin bars, ghoulish cup cakes, peanut butter pie and more.

NCL’s signature Freestyle Cruising offers guests the flexibility of having no fixed schedules or dining times, no formal dress codes and a variety of activity options. Halloween guests can jump on their broom stick any time to enjoy dining at different on-board restaurants each night of their ghoulish journey, savor Halloween cocktails on their own schedule, explore exotic destinations or simply do nothing at all!
